WEXNER CENTER’S FALL 2013 SEASON ANNOUNCED
A world premiere by the Quay Brothers (including an in-person appearance by the filmmakers themselves) and new restorations of classic Hitchcock silent films; new work
from Nature Theater of Oklahoma, Young Jean Lee, and Elevator Repair Service; music from local talent such as Byron Stripling and Brian Harnetty (and by performers from around the globe, such as the desert bluesman Terakaft);
and a conversation with architect Steven Holl are among the many events on deck this fall at the Wexner Center for the Arts, which will also see the acclaimed interdisciplinary exhibition Blues For Smoke filling all of its galleries. Member
presale runs August 1–11; public ticket sales begin August 12.
